Smith & Wesson
Features
Founded in 1852, Smith and Wesson, or S&W, are one of the oldest gun manufacturers. They are well known for their innovative design and high-quality manufacturing. They offer many great revolvers for concealment. Most of Smith & Wesson’s revolvers are made of an aluminum alloy frame and stainless steel cylinder. This makes them mostly immune to heat and moisture. These materials help combat rust.
There are many options offered by Smith & Wesson that are worth considering. Model 19 Classic, M&P Bodyguard 38 No, Model 642 LS Ladysmith, Model Governor and Performance Center Model 686 are ideal starter options.

Colt
Features
Samuel Colt patented his mechanism in 1836, which popularized the use of revolvers in the old west and military. They have been providing quality firearms for over 160 years. When people think about a revolver, they most often picture a Colt.
Colt has had a huge impact on firearms over the years. While Colt is hard on the budget, the craftsmanship alone is worth the money. Be sure to consider the Colt Cobra, Night Cobra, and SA Army range.

North American Arms
Features
North American Arms is a small company out of Provo, Utah. They offer a unique safety notch feature within the cylinder that allows you to carry the gun fully loaded without fear of accidentally discharging it. They offer mini revolvers and pocket revolvers in several models which include 22 short, companion, 32 NAA guardian, and ranger. For all models except the Sidewinder, the user must remove the cylinder in order to reload it.

Taurus
Features
What started out as a small company in Brazil, Taurus Holdings Inc has become a well-known name in the gun community. They were the first small arms company to offer a lifetime repair policy. They also patented and invented the Taurus Security System. This allows the user to lock the firearm with a special key.
While locked, the user cannot cock the hammer or pull the trigger. They offer this system on most of the guns within the Taurus brand. Just a few of the models offered are 856 Model 2, 692 Model 2, Raging Judge 513, The Judge, and CIA 650.

JANZ Präzisionstechnik
Features
JANZ Präzisionstechnik is a German-based company. They provided Korth with parts for several years before making their own revolvers. They offer the quick change system which allows for easy conversion between .22 and .45. They offer barrel lengths from 2.5 inches to 12 inches long. The guns are beautiful, and the surfaces are all tempered and polished. They also offer engraving services. The company does not have a lot of models, but they offer Type MA large caliber, Type E, and M fixed caliber models.

Rossi
Features
While Rossi doesn’t offer as many options as a few of the other manufacturers on our list, they do not lack in quality. There are two options: the Rossi .38 Special, and the Magnum .357. The Rossi .38 Special is available in 6 variations and has a 5 shot chamber. The Magnum .357 is available in 8 variations and has a 6 shot chamber. You can find both in either blue steel or stainless steel and with a short or long barrel. Each model has the Taurus Security System, allowing the user to lock the firearm with a special key. When activated, the user cannot cock the hammer or pull the trigger.
